How you make a difference

The Dental Assistant job position requires a candidate who can support the dentist or designee by documenting dental services provided. This involves maintaining accurate dental charts, recording dental findings, and scheduling appointments in a timely manner. The ideal candidate must possess excellent organizational skills, attention to detail, and the ability to work efficiently as part of a team. 

Key Responsibilities

  • The Dental Assistant provides chair-side assistance to the dentist by passing instruments, keeping the operating field clear, and suctioning. They take x-rays, pour impression casts, maintain logs, and escort patients to and from the waiting area while documenting as required. Effective communication with patients is a key requirement for this position. 
  • Maintaining cleanliness and sanitation of the dental clinic, sterilizing instruments, cleaning equipment, ordering supplies, and arranging for equipment repair and routine maintenance, are daily operational functions performed in accordance with OSHA standards and infection control policies. 
  • Participation in ongoing quality improvement and chart review activities is required to ensure a high standard of patient care is maintained. 
  • Scheduling patients for appointments, follow-ups, and notifications of appointments is part of the role. The Dental Assistant should be sensitive to cultural diversity issues and treat patients with individual care and treatment consistent with their age and developmental needs. 
  • Continued professional development through workshops, conferences, self-study, and in-service education is necessary to maintain current knowledge and applicable skills. Additionally, knowledge of disaster and fire procedures, infection control, and risk management is expected. 

Qualifications & Requirements

Education

  • High School diploma or its equivalent. 

Experience

  • Completed Dental Assistant Program. Two (2) years dental assistant experience to include assisting and sterilization techniques, knowledge of dental procedures and equipment, infections control, and safety measures procedures.

Licenses/Certifications

  • Certification as a Dental Assistant is required.
